In the RGB color model, hex triplet #314204 has decimal index of: 3228164, is composed of 19.2% red, 25.9% green and 1.6% blue. #314204 in CMYK color model, is composed of 25.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 93.9% yellow and 74.1% black.
#333300 is the closest web-safe color to #314204.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.
